Michael Cowling is a scholar working on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, Human-Computer Interaction and Information Systems. According to data from OpenAlex, Michael Cowling has authored 57 papers receiving a total of 717 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 16 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, 15 papers in Human-Computer Interaction and 12 papers in Information Systems. Recurrent topics in Michael Cowling's work include Augmented Reality Applications (15 papers), Virtual Reality Applications and Impacts (14 papers) and Educational Games and Gamification (7 papers). Michael Cowling is often cited by papers focused on Augmented Reality Applications (15 papers), Virtual Reality Applications and Impacts (14 papers) and Educational Games and Gamification (7 papers). Michael Cowling collaborates with scholars based in Australia, New Zealand and United States. Michael Cowling's co-authors include James Birt, Renate Sitte, Zane Štromberga, Christian Moro, Joseph Crawford, Kelly‐Ann Allen, Ritesh Chugh, Darren Turnbull, Rebekkah Middleton and Jo‐Anne Kelder and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Journal of the Association for Information Systems and Pattern Recognition Letters.
